Honeymoon Itinerary: Paris, Amsterdam, Prague

Thursday, February 8: Arrival in Paris

Welcome to the City of Love! Begin your honeymoon by exploring the iconic Eiffel Tower in the morning. Take a romantic stroll along the Seine River in the afternoon, enjoying the picturesque views and stopping by charming riverside cafes. In the evening, visit Montmartre, known for its bohemian atmosphere and the stunning Sacré-Cœur Basilica.

  • Eiffel Tower: €25, 2-3 hours
  • Seine River: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Montmartre: Free, 2-3 hours
Friday, February 9: Parisian Delights

Indulge in Parisian delights by starting your day with a visit to the Louvre Museum, home to countless masterpieces including the Mona Lisa. Enjoy a leisurely lunch at a sidewalk cafe and savor some delicious French cuisine. Spend the evening exploring the charming neighborhood of Le Marais, known for its quaint streets, trendy shops, and vibrant nightlife.

  • Louvre Museum: €17, 3-4 hours
  • Le Marais: Free, 2-3 hours
Saturday, February 10: Amsterdam Arrival

Travel from Paris to Amsterdam. Engage in the delightful Dutch culture by visiting the Anne Frank House in the morning, gaining insights into the poignant history of World War II. In the afternoon, take a scenic canal cruise to admire the beautiful architecture and charming canal houses. Spend the evening exploring the vibrant nightlife of the famous Red Light District.

  • Anne Frank House: €10, 2-3 hours
  • Canal Cruise: €20, 1-2 hours
  • Red Light District: Free, 2-3 hours
Sunday, February 11: Amsterdam's Rich Heritage

Explore Amsterdam's rich heritage by visiting the Van Gogh Museum in the morning, housing an impressive collection of the renowned artist's works. Enjoy a relaxing afternoon at Vondelpark, the largest park in the city, perfect for picnics and leisurely walks. In the evening, experience the lively atmosphere of the Jordaan neighborhood with its charming cafes, art galleries, and boutiques.

  • Van Gogh Museum: €19, 2-3 hours
  • Vondelpark: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Jordaan: Free, 2-3 hours
Monday, February 12: Journey to Prague

Travel from Amsterdam to Prague. Begin your exploration of Prague by visiting the enchanting Prague Castle in the morning, offering bre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, wander through the charming streets of Old Town Square and marvel at the astronomical clock. End the day by enjoying a traditional Czech dinner in a cozy restaurant.

  • Prague Castle: €10, 2-3 hours
  • Old Town Square: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Traditional Czech Dinner: €30, 1-2 hours
Tuesday, February 13: Prague's Cultural Gems

Immerse yourself in Prague's cultural gems by visiting the stunning St. Vitus Cathedral in the morning, a masterpiece of Gothic architecture. Explore the picturesque Charles Bridge in the afternoon, adorned with statues and offering panoramic views of the city. In the evening, enjoy a classical music concert, a signature experience in the city of Mozart.

  • St. Vitus Cathedral: €5, 1-2 hours
  • Charles Bridge: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Classical Music Concert: €50, 2-3 hours
Wednesday, February 14: Farewell to Prague

End your honeymoon with a visit to the beautiful Prague Astronomical Clock in the morning, known for its intricate design and hourly show. Explore the vibrant neighborhood of Žižkov in the afternoon, filled with quirky bars, cafes, and a unique atmosphere. Bid Prague farewell by enjoying a romantic dinner cruise along the Vltava River in the evening.

  • Prague Astronomical Clock: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Žižkov: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Romantic Dinner Cruise: €60, 2-3 hours
